Analysis

The most recent figure for methane (ch4) emissions from power industry (energy) in Senegal is 0.0063 Mt CO2e, measured in 2024. That is the highest value across all 55 years on record.

Compared with earlier readings it is up 1.6% on the previous year and up 31.2% over ten years.

Over the whole period, methane (ch4) emissions from power industry (energy) in Senegal peaked at 0.0063 Mt CO2e in 2024 and was at its lowest, 0.0018 Mt CO2e, in 1970.

That places Senegal 92nd out of 194 countries with data for 2024, putting it in the middle of the range.

The long-run direction has been consistently rising across the 55 years of available data.

A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from electricity and heat generation (subsector of the energy sector) including IPCC 2006 code 1.A.1.a.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
